How It Works

1.

Tell Us About Your Watch

First, find the watch you want to sell, then add your personal details to the form. Top tip: searching with the model number makes it simple to find.

2.

Pre-Paid Shipping

We’ll send you an estimate for your watch. Our offers are based on a number of factors, including demand for this watch and our current stock level. If you’re happy with it, our US service center will send you packaging and a pre-paid shipping label. You can then post us your watch safely and securely, along with its box and paperwork, if you have them. Or if you prefer, you can leave your watch with our experts at our SoHo boutique, and they’ll handle the rest for you.

3.

Watch Inspection

One of our expert watchmakers will inspect your watch when it arrives at our in-house service center in Dallas. If we need to do any work on the watch to bring it up to Watchfinder’s resale standards, we may deduct a servicing fee. If this is the case, we’ll let you know when we make you a final offer for your watch.

4.

Payment Made

Once we have inspected your watch, we’ll make a final offer. If you’re happy to go ahead, let us know and we’ll send the money to you within three days by bank transfer. Do I need the watch box and papers?

We are happy to buy your watch if you do not have the box and papers but please note, their absence can affect the value. We will also need proof of purchase if you do not have the box and papers.

How long is my quote valid for?"

Your initial quote is valid for up to 7 days.

If you’re happy with your initial quote, we need to collect your watch for inspection and authentication to give you a final offer. We can collect your watch with our free fully-insured home collection service – we’ll even send you special packaging to keep it safe. Or you can drop it off at one of our boutiques. Whichever service you choose, you will need to print your postal slip and include this with your watch.

If you wish to go ahead with the sale your watch must arrive with us within 7 days of your quote confirmation.

Please note, we do not include any servicing fees in the initial quote. Once we have inspected your watch, we will send you your final offer, which will include any deductions.

Your final offer is valid for up to 5 days.

If your quote expires at any stage of the process, you can request an updated quote. Please note, our offer may change, or we may not wish to continue with your sale.
